During his visit to Jakarta to attend a Bible conference, I was invited to be a speaker at a church there. Before the service the first of two Sunday morning worship service begins, an elder asked me to hand him my Bible. He explained that the elders are responsible for the accuracy of the biblical teaching that will be accepted by the church, and he will restore the Bible to me in front of them. This is a tangible way to demonstrate to the people that their leaders preaching entrusted to me that day.
This habit of reminding us to always be vigilant. This habit also uplifting. I am reminded that the privilege to introduce to others the truth of the Bible can not be taken lightly. However, it is also encouraging when we see how serious this Indonesian elders in charge of shepherding their congregations.

In Acts 20, we read that Paul met with the elders of the church at Ephesus. In his address to the leaders, the apostle warns them of the dangers of false teachers (verses 28,29) and the responsibility of church leaders to help the church grow in the word of God (verse 32).

Whatever our vocation, treat God's word carefully. If we have to be careful, God's people will grow - WEC
